Troubleshooting Common CNC Drilling Problems

Experiencing setbacks with your CNC boring machine? Several common problems can hinder productivity. One significant area to copyrightine is the rotating tool itself; broken bits cause poor hole quality and chatter. Furthermore , ensure the workpiece is securely fastened to the surface to prevent movement . Feed rates and spindle speeds might need modification based on the substance being worked; too high a rate can lead to tool breakage . Finally, confirm your instructions for errors; even a slight mistake can lead to inaccurate hole location.

CNC Drilling Machine Upkeep : Best Procedures

To ensure peak operation of your drilling machine , scheduled upkeep is absolutely important . Routine inspections of oil levels, cutting fluid condition, and chip clearing are crucial. Moreover, periodic purging of air systems and electronic components enables prevent malfunctions and prolongs machine longevity . Ultimately, adhering the maker’s guidelines for preventative servicing is imperative for reliable productivity .
